Production d'un JSON à importer dans DMP OPIDoR

Depuis la version V3.1.0 de DMP OPIDoR (mai 2022), il est possible d’importer un PGD en format JSON pour le reprendre dans DMP OPIDoR.

Connaissez-vous des cas d’usage de cette fonctionnalité ? J’ai en tête un petit projet qui consisterait à commencer à rédiger un PGD dans un tableur, puis l’importer dans DMP OPIDoR pour le finaliser. Ce qui nécessite un script (Python sans doute) pour transformer le tableau en JSON :slight_smile:

3 « J'aime »

L’idée de disposer d’un petit script pour permettre aux rédacteurs des pgd de commencer avec un tableur s’ils le souhaite est très bonne; j’ai peu de compétences python mais si tu veux de l’aide n’hésite pas

1 « J'aime »

Nous utilisons json dans le cas d’usage d’interopérabilité entre DSW https://ds-wizard.org/ (un autre outil de support aux PGDs) et DMP OPIDoR.

2 « J'aime »

Le projet que j’évoquais a vu le jour : je vous présente le script Python de conversion CSV - JSON pour DMP OPIDoR qui facilite l’import de données en format tabulaire (fichier CSV) dans l’outil DMP OPIDoR, par le truchement d’un fichier JSON.

Ce travail d’une étudiante de l’université de Bordeaux qu’@AnnaLoeff et moi avons accueilli en stage, Sara Ben Brahim, correspond à certains cas d’usage de DMP OPIDoR où les infos utiles au PGD sont d’abord saisies dans une grille (sous Excel, Airtable, Grist…) lors de l’échange avec les chercheurs, puis reprises dans DMP OPIDoR à tête reposée.

Procéder ainsi nous permet de simplifier la prise de notes et de diviser les champs du PGD en sous-questions, pour être sûr de ne rien oublier. Notre grille (sur laquelle le script est paramétré) est inspirée du Sprint PGD produit par Datactivist.

N’hésitez pas à nous faire des retours si vous utilisez ce script ou si le sujet vous intéresse !

2 « J'aime »